Scope and Contents
Natural Foods Institute. William Grover Barnard (also known as "Papa" Barnard) sells the tri-grater, a simple grinder that fastens to the side of a table and slices and cuts fruits, vegetables, nuts, seeds, and other foods. He demonstrates how the machine functions and prepares a Hollywood rainbow salad. Throughout his pitch, Barnard appeals specifically to mothers and encourages them to use the tri-grater to feed their families more nutrient-dense meals.
